本文比较了多种现有的烃类饱和蒸气压推算方法,结果表明对 C-{10}以上的烃在常沸点以下以 Lee-Kesler 的经验式(B)为最佳。本文还提出为了进行这类计算所需初始值的经验式和误差方法,以便程序化求解。
